P1030 error code, Valvetronic motor or eccentric shaft sensor?
In the recent few month I keep getting error code P1030 (2A68) which description says Valvetronic motor movement sluggish. Unlike what others have seen, I got no other error codes.
This codes and the half yellow check engine light comes up only during aggressive downshifts from 6 to 3 (directly) on highway, not on tracks since the downshifts are sequential. The only problem is how I can determine if it's the motor itself or it's the sensor? In other people's experiences, most likely when the sensor fails, they got more than one error codes at all the time, but my situation is only one error code and with the condition described above, should I go ahead and change the motor? |
